CohBar’s CEO to Participate on the New Breakthroughs in Aging Biology Panel at the BIO 2020 Digital Conference


MENLO PARK, Calif., May 27,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- CohBar, Inc. (NASDAQ: CWBR), a clinical stage biotechnology company developing mitochondria based therapeutics to treat chronic diseases and extend healthy lifespan, today announced its Chief Executive Officer, Steven Engle will be a participant on the panel titled “Redefining What it Means to Get Old: New Breakthroughs in Aging Biology” at the BIO 2020 Digital Conference, to be held on June 8-12, 2020.

The panel, featuring Nathaniel David, Co-Founder and President of Unity Biotechnology, Tom Hughes, CEO of Navitor Pharmaceuticals and Steven Engle, CEO of CohBar, will be moderated by Hannah Kuchler, US Pharma and Biotech Correspondent for the Financial Times. The panelists are leaders and trail blazers in the field of aging who are pioneering research in cellular senescence, mTORC dysregulation and mitochondrial dysfunction.  They will discuss recent scientific breakthroughs which go beyond masking the pain associated with age-related diseases to developing therapies designed to intervene and target the underlying mechanisms of these diseases. This panel session will be available on demand for BIO Digital attendees beginning on June 8, 2020. Also during the conference, Mr. Engle will present a corporate overview on CohBar’s technology platform, which will be available on demand as well.

About CohBar

CohBar (NASDAQ: CWBR) is a clinical stage biotechnology company focused on the research and development of mitochondria based therapeutics, an emerging class of drugs for the treatment of chronic and age-related diseases. Mitochondria based therapeutics originate from the discovery by CohBar’s founders of a novel group of naturally occurring mitochondrial-derived peptides within the mitochondrial genome that regulate metabolism and cell death, and whose biological activity declines with age. To date, the company has discovered more than 100 mitochondrial derived peptides and generated over 1,000 analogs. CohBar’s efforts focus on the development of these peptides into therapeutics that offer the potential to address a broad range of diseases, including nonalc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), obesity, fibrotic diseases, cancer, ac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S), type 2 diabetes, and cardiovascular and neurodegenerative diseases. The company’s lead compound, CB4211, is in the Phase 1b stage of a Phase 1a/1b clinical trial for NASH and obesity.  This clinical trial is currently paused due to the COVID-19 pandemic. In addition, CohBar has four preclinical programs, two in cancer, one in fibrotic diseases and one in COVID-19 associated ARDS and type 2 diabetes.
